What is the typical cost of installing casement windows?
On average, the cost of installing casement windows can range from 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,000 per window, depending upon the materials, size, and extra personalizations. It's best to seek advice from a specialist for a customized quote.
2. How can I maintain my casement windows?
Regular upkeep involves cleaning up the glass and frames, oiling the hinges, and checking seals for air leaks. A specialist can also provide seasonal upkeep ideas.
3. Are casement windows energy-efficient?
Yes, casement windows tend to be more energy-efficient than some other styles due to the fact that they seal securely when closed, decreasing air leakage. Select double or triple-pane glass choices for even higher efficiency.
4. Can I change my traditional windows with casement windows?
Yes, it is possible to replace traditional windows with casement windows. A casement window specialist can evaluate your home and offer guidance on retrofitting or structural adjustments if needed.
5. The length of time do casement windows last?
With correct upkeep, casement windows can last anywhere from 20 to 40 years or longer, depending upon the materials used and the environmental conditions.
